Prior to the recent software update, when I was on a call the proximity sensor would correctly turn the screen black until I took the phone from my ear at which point I'd get the call screen and could press "end" to hang up. Since the update, when I take the phone from my ear, it stays dark and I have to press the power button to bring up the lockscreen and unlock it to end the call or wait til the other party disconnects.
Anyone else been experiencing this? Any suggestions or fixes?

I had the same problem. I did not have it when I bought the phone. I went back and looked at the apps I had installed since then and discovered a memory booster program I had installed must have been killing the system file that controlled the proximity sensor. I uninstalled the app, powered down the phone and powered it up. I no longer have the problem of taking the phone from my ear and it locking and screen going out keeping me from ending the call. When I take the phone from my ear now I have access to the end call button. Just thought I would mentioned it as a possible solution.
